| /src/external/mpl/bind/dist/tests/dns/ |
| db_test.c | 31 #include <dns/rdatalist.h> 103 dns_rdatalist_t rdatalist; local 135 dns_rdatalist_init(&rdatalist); 136 rdatalist.ttl = 2; 137 rdatalist.type = dns_rdatatype_a; 138 rdatalist.rdclass = dns_rdataclass_in; 139 ISC_LIST_APPEND(rdatalist.rdata, &rdata, link); 158 dns_rdatalist_tordataset(&rdatalist, &rdataset);
|
| dns64_test.c | 35 #include <dns/rdatalist.h> 53 dns_rdatalist_t rdatalist; local 65 dns_rdatalist_init(&rdatalist); 72 ISC_LIST_APPEND(rdatalist.rdata, &rdata[i], link); 74 rdatalist.type = rdata[0].type; 75 rdatalist.rdclass = rdata[0].rdclass; 76 rdatalist.ttl = 0; 78 dns_rdatalist_tordataset(&rdatalist, &rdataset); 172 dns_rdatalist_t rdatalist; local 204 dns_rdatalist_init(&rdatalist); [all...] |
| qpdb_test.c | 31 #include <dns/rdatalist.h> 61 dns_rdatalist_t rdatalist; local 99 dns_rdatalist_init(&rdatalist); 100 rdatalist.rdclass = dns_rdataclass_in; 101 rdatalist.type = rtype; 102 rdatalist.ttl = 3600; 103 ISC_LIST_APPEND(rdatalist.rdata, &rdata, link); 106 dns_rdatalist_tordataset(&rdatalist, &rdataset);
|
| master_test.c | 40 #include <dns/rdatalist.h> 390 dns_rdatalist_t rdatalist; local 397 dns_rdatalist_init(&rdatalist); 398 rdatalist.rdclass = dns_rdataclass_in; 399 rdatalist.type = dns_rdatatype_none; 400 rdatalist.covers = dns_rdatatype_none; 403 dns_rdatalist_tordataset(&rdatalist, &rdataset);
|
| dbversion_test.c | 37 #include <dns/rdatalist.h> 280 dns_rdatalist_t rdatalist; local 286 dns_rdatalist_init(&rdatalist); 288 rdatalist.rdclass = dns_rdataclass_in; 290 dns_rdatalist_tordataset(&rdatalist, &rdataset); 303 dns_rdatalist_tordataset(&rdatalist, &rdataset); 320 dns_rdatalist_t rdatalist; local 325 dns_rdatalist_init(&rdatalist); 327 rdatalist.rdclass = dns_rdataclass_in; 329 dns_rdatalist_tordataset(&rdatalist, &rdataset) [all...] |
| qpzone_test.c | 33 #include <dns/rdatalist.h> 269 dns_rdatalist_t rdatalist; local 284 dns_rdatalist_init(&rdatalist); 285 rdatalist.ttl = ttl; 286 rdatalist.type = rdtype; 287 rdatalist.rdclass = rdclass; 288 ISC_LIST_APPEND(rdatalist.rdata, &rdata, link); 291 dns_rdatalist_tordataset(&rdatalist, &rdataset);
|
| tsig_test.c | 33 #include <dns/rdatalist.h> 96 dns_rdatalist_t rdatalist; local 143 dns_rdatalist_init(&rdatalist); 144 rdatalist.rdclass = dns_rdataclass_any; 145 rdatalist.type = dns_rdatatype_tsig; 146 ISC_LIST_APPEND(rdatalist.rdata, &rdata, link); 148 dns_rdatalist_tordataset(&rdatalist, &rdataset);
|
| skr_test.c | 38 #include <dns/rdatalist.h> 112 dns_rdatalist_t *rdatalist = isc_mem_get(mctx, sizeof(*rdatalist)); local 113 dns_rdatalist_init(rdatalist); 114 rdatalist->rdclass = dns_rdataclass_in; 115 rdatalist->type = rdata->type; 116 rdatalist->ttl = TTL; 118 ISC_LIST_APPEND(rdatalist->rdata, rdata, link); 119 dns_rdatalist_tordataset(rdatalist, &rrset); 132 for (dns_rdata_t *rd = ISC_LIST_HEAD(rdatalist->rdata); rd != NULL [all...] |
| /src/external/mpl/bind/dist/lib/dns/ |
| rdatalist.c | 1 /* $NetBSD: rdatalist.c,v 1.8 2025/01/26 16:25:24 christos Exp $ */ 26 #include <dns/rdatalist.h> 45 dns_rdatalist_init(dns_rdatalist_t *rdatalist) { 46 REQUIRE(rdatalist != NULL); 49 * Initialize rdatalist. 51 *rdatalist = (dns_rdatalist_t){ 55 memset(rdatalist->upper, 0xeb, sizeof(rdatalist->upper)); 60 rdatalist->upper[0] &= ~0x01; 64 dns_rdatalist_tordataset(dns_rdatalist_t *rdatalist, dns_rdataset_t *rdataset) 107 dns_rdatalist_t *rdatalist = NULL; local 160 dns_rdatalist_t *rdatalist; local 392 dns_rdatalist_t *rdatalist; local 414 dns_rdatalist_t *rdatalist; local [all...] |
| nsec.c | 28 #include <dns/rdatalist.h> 181 dns_rdatalist_t rdatalist; local 192 dns_rdatalist_init(&rdatalist); 193 rdatalist.rdclass = dns_db_class(db); 194 rdatalist.type = dns_rdatatype_nsec; 195 rdatalist.ttl = ttl; 196 ISC_LIST_APPEND(rdatalist.rdata, &rdata, link); 197 dns_rdatalist_tordataset(&rdatalist, &rdataset);
|
| sdlz.c | 78 #include <dns/rdatalist.h> 190 list_tordataset(dns_rdatalist_t *rdatalist, dns_db_t *db, dns_dbnode_t *node, 1345 list_tordataset(dns_rdatalist_t *rdatalist, dns_db_t *db, dns_dbnode_t *node, 1348 * The sdlz rdataset is an rdatalist, but additionally holds 1352 dns_rdatalist_tordataset(rdatalist, rdataset); 1677 dns_rdatalist_t *rdatalist; local 1702 rdatalist = ISC_LIST_HEAD(lookup->lists); 1703 while (rdatalist != NULL) { 1704 if (rdatalist->type == typeval) { 1707 rdatalist = ISC_LIST_NEXT(rdatalist, link) [all...] |
| master.c | 42 #include <dns/rdatalist.h> 761 dns_rdatalist_t rdatalist; local 877 dns_rdatalist_init(&rdatalist); 878 rdatalist.type = type; 879 rdatalist.rdclass = lctx->zclass; 880 rdatalist.ttl = lctx->ttl; 881 ISC_LIST_PREPEND(head, &rdatalist, link); 882 ISC_LIST_APPEND(rdatalist.rdata, &rdata, link); 884 ISC_LIST_UNLINK(rdatalist.rdata, &rdata, link); 1025 dns_rdatalist_t *rdatalist = NULL local 2342 dns_rdatalist_t rdatalist; local [all...] |
| message.c | 47 #include <dns/rdatalist.h> 350 releaserdatalist(dns_message_t *msg, dns_rdatalist_t *rdatalist) { 351 ISC_LIST_PREPEND(msg->freerdatalist, rdatalist, link); 357 dns_rdatalist_t *rdatalist; local 359 rdatalist = ISC_LIST_HEAD(msg->freerdatalist); 360 if (rdatalist != NULL) { 361 ISC_LIST_UNLINK(msg->freerdatalist, rdatalist, link); 366 rdatalist = msgblock_get(msgblock, dns_rdatalist_t); 367 if (rdatalist == NULL) { 372 rdatalist = msgblock_get(msgblock, dns_rdatalist_t) 558 dns_rdatalist_t *rdatalist = NULL; local 991 dns_rdatalist_t *rdatalist = NULL; local 1201 dns_rdatalist_t *rdatalist = NULL; local 4888 dns_rdatalist_t *rdatalist = NULL; local [all...] |
| /src/external/mpl/dhcp/bind/dist/lib/dns/ |
| rdatalist.c | 1 /* $NetBSD: rdatalist.c,v 1.1 2024/02/18 20:57:33 christos Exp $ */ 26 #include <dns/rdatalist.h> 51 dns_rdatalist_init(dns_rdatalist_t *rdatalist) { 52 REQUIRE(rdatalist != NULL); 55 * Initialize rdatalist. 58 rdatalist->rdclass = 0; 59 rdatalist->type = 0; 60 rdatalist->covers = 0; 61 rdatalist->ttl = 0; 62 ISC_LIST_INIT(rdatalist->rdata) 115 dns_rdatalist_t *rdatalist; local 174 dns_rdatalist_t *rdatalist; local 404 dns_rdatalist_t *rdatalist; local 429 dns_rdatalist_t *rdatalist; local [all...] |
| nsec.c | 27 #include <dns/rdatalist.h> 188 dns_rdatalist_t rdatalist; local 196 dns_rdatalist_init(&rdatalist); 197 rdatalist.rdclass = dns_db_class(db); 198 rdatalist.type = dns_rdatatype_nsec; 199 rdatalist.ttl = ttl; 200 ISC_LIST_APPEND(rdatalist.rdata, &rdata, link); 201 RETERR(dns_rdatalist_tordataset(&rdatalist, &rdataset));
|
| sdb.c | 39 #include <dns/rdatalist.h> 161 list_tordataset(dns_rdatalist_t *rdatalist, dns_db_t *db, dns_dbnode_t *node, 277 dns_rdatalist_t *rdatalist; local 285 rdatalist = ISC_LIST_HEAD(lookup->lists); 286 while (rdatalist != NULL) { 287 if (rdatalist->type == typeval) { 290 rdatalist = ISC_LIST_NEXT(rdatalist, link); 293 if (rdatalist == NULL) { 294 rdatalist = isc_mem_get(mctx, sizeof(dns_rdatalist_t)) [all...] |
| client.c | 43 #include <dns/rdatalist.h> 2464 dns_rdatalist_t *rdatalist; local 2481 rdatalist = NULL; 2482 result = dns_message_gettemprdatalist(msg, &rdatalist); 2486 dns_rdatalist_init(rdatalist); 2487 rdatalist->type = rdataset->type; 2488 rdatalist->rdclass = rdataset->rdclass; 2489 rdatalist->covers = rdataset->covers; 2490 rdatalist->ttl = rdataset->ttl; 2512 ISC_LIST_APPEND(rdatalist->rdata, newrdata, link) 2966 dns_rdatalist_t rdatalist; member in struct:__anon24245 3077 dns_rdatalist_t *rdatalist; local [all...] |
| master.c | 42 #include <dns/rdatalist.h> 816 dns_rdatalist_t rdatalist; local 932 dns_rdatalist_init(&rdatalist); 933 rdatalist.type = type; 934 rdatalist.rdclass = lctx->zclass; 935 rdatalist.ttl = lctx->ttl; 936 ISC_LIST_PREPEND(head, &rdatalist, link); 937 ISC_LIST_APPEND(rdatalist.rdata, &rdata, link); 939 ISC_LIST_UNLINK(rdatalist.rdata, &rdata, link); 1081 dns_rdatalist_t *rdatalist = NULL local 2424 dns_rdatalist_t rdatalist; local [all...] |
| sdlz.c | 77 #include <dns/rdatalist.h> 195 list_tordataset(dns_rdatalist_t *rdatalist, dns_db_t *db, dns_dbnode_t *node, 1461 list_tordataset(dns_rdatalist_t *rdatalist, dns_db_t *db, dns_dbnode_t *node, 1464 * The sdlz rdataset is an rdatalist with some additions. 1465 * - private1 & private2 are used by the rdatalist. 1471 RUNTIME_CHECK(dns_rdatalist_tordataset(rdatalist, rdataset) == 1806 dns_rdatalist_t *rdatalist; local 1831 rdatalist = ISC_LIST_HEAD(lookup->lists); 1832 while (rdatalist != NULL) { 1833 if (rdatalist->type == typeval) [all...] |
| /src/external/mpl/bind/dist/bin/tests/system/dyndb/driver/ |
| db.c | 54 #include <dns/rdatalist.h> 482 dns_rdatalist_t rdatalist; local 488 dns_rdatalist_init(&rdatalist); 491 rdatalist.type = rdata.type; 492 rdatalist.covers = 0; 493 rdatalist.rdclass = rdata.rdclass; 494 rdatalist.ttl = 86400; 495 ISC_LIST_APPEND(rdatalist.rdata, &rdata, link); 496 dns_rdatalist_tordataset(&rdatalist, &rdataset); 512 dns_rdatalist_t rdatalist; local 550 dns_rdatalist_t rdatalist; local [all...] |
| /src/external/mpl/bind/dist/bin/named/ |
| builtin.c | 31 #include <dns/rdatalist.h> 101 dns_rdatalist_t *rdatalist = NULL; local 109 rdatalist = ISC_LIST_HEAD(node->lists); 110 while (rdatalist != NULL) { 111 if (rdatalist->type == typeval) { 114 rdatalist = ISC_LIST_NEXT(rdatalist, link); 117 if (rdatalist == NULL) { 118 rdatalist = isc_mem_get(mctx, sizeof(dns_rdatalist_t)); 119 dns_rdatalist_init(rdatalist); [all...] |
| zoneconf.c | 38 #include <dns/rdatalist.h> 402 dns_rdatalist_t *rdatalist; local 423 rdatalist = rdatalist_a; 428 rdatalist = rdatalist_aaaa; 437 rdatalist->type, ®ion); 438 ISC_LIST_APPEND(rdatalist->rdata, rdata, link); 473 dns_rdatalist_t *rdatalist, 521 ISC_LIST_APPEND(rdatalist->rdata, rdata, link);
|
| /src/external/mpl/dhcp/dist/common/ |
| dns.c | 155 dns_rdatalist_t rdatalist; member in struct:dhcp_ddns_rdata 1718 * must be correct already. We then link the rdatalist to the rdata and 1719 * create a rdataset from the rdatalist. 1731 dns_rdatalist_t *rdatalist = &dataspace->rdatalist; local 1765 dns_rdatalist_init(rdatalist); 1766 rdatalist->type = datatype; 1767 rdatalist->rdclass = dataclass; 1768 rdatalist->ttl = ttl; 1769 ISC_LIST_APPEND(rdatalist->rdata, rdata, link) [all...] |
| /src/external/mpl/bind/dist/bin/dnssec/ |
| dnssec-ksr.c | 33 #include <dns/rdatalist.h> 562 dns_rdatalist_t *rdatalist = NULL; local 572 rdatalist = isc_mem_get(mctx, sizeof(*rdatalist)); 573 dns_rdatalist_init(rdatalist); 574 rdatalist->rdclass = dns_rdataclass_in; 575 rdatalist->type = dns_rdatatype_dnskey; 576 rdatalist->ttl = ttl; 619 ISC_LIST_APPEND(rdatalist->rdata, rdata, link); 624 if (ISC_LIST_EMPTY(rdatalist->rdata)) 1173 dns_rdatalist_t *rdatalist = NULL; local [all...] |
| /src/external/mpl/bind/dist/bin/dig/ |
| dighost.c | 74 #include <dns/rdatalist.h> 2088 dns_rdatalist_t *rdatalist = NULL; local 2117 dns_message_gettemprdatalist(lookup->sendmsg, &rdatalist); 2121 dns_rdatalist_init(rdatalist); 2122 rdatalist->type = dns_rdatatype_soa; 2123 rdatalist->rdclass = lookup->rdclass; 2124 ISC_LIST_APPEND(rdatalist->rdata, rdata, link); 2126 dns_rdatalist_tordataset(rdatalist, rdataset);
|